/*
 Theme Name:   Pure & Simple
 Description:  Child Theme
 Author:       Webmaster
 Template:     pure-simple
 Version:      1.0
 Text Domain:  pure-simple-child
*/

body {
	background-color: #b2caea;
}

#page {
	border:none;
	box-shadow:none;
}

h1 {
	color:#282878;
	font-size: 25pt !important;
	line-height: 30pt;
	margin-bottom:40px !important;
}

.header-inner {
    padding:0 40px !important;
}

#page-banner .textwidget {
	padding-bottom:80px;
	background-color: #b2caea;
}

#page-banner .textwidget p {
    text-align:center;
    color:#fff;
    background-color:#b2caea;
}

#page-banner .textwidget #zitat {
	font-family: "mrs-eaves";
	font-size:70pt;
	line-height:70pt;
}

#page-banner .textwidget #autor {
	font-family: "nunito-sans-regular";
	font-size: 18pt;
	margin-top:40px;
}

#content {
    font-size: 15pt !important;
	font-family: "nunito-sans-regular";
	line-height: 25pt;
}

#content p {
	margin-bottom:30px;
}

.entry-title {
    display:none;
}

.entry-content {
	margin-top:30px;
	width:70%;
	margin-left:auto;
    margin-right:auto;
}

#footer-content {
	padding:18px 0 20px 0;
}

#footer-content .textwidget p {
	margin-top:10px;
}

#site-footer {
	font-family:"nunito-sans-semibold";
}

#footer-content p {
	font-size:16px;
}

@media screen and (max-width: 460px) { 
	
	#page-banner .textwidget p {
		padding:10px;
	}
	
	#page-banner .textwidget #zitat {
		font-size:40pt !important;
		line-height:50pt;
	}

	#page-banner .textwidget #autor {
		font-size: 16pt;
		margin-top:40px;
	}
	
	#page-banner .textwidget {
		padding-bottom:40px;
	}
	
	h1 {
		font-size: 21pt !important;
		margin-top:-15px;
	}
	
	.entry-content {
		width:90%;
}
	
}